I got this slot cooler for $10 US ("open box" at Fry's but had obviously never been used) and it's worked well for me. Was getting GPU related crashes in BioShock & 3DMark06 prior to the VCool and haven't had any since putting it in. 3 speeds, nothing to the installation (as long as you have 2 free slots) and it's not too loud even at the top speed.

I don't have good temp info, but I'd say 5C - 15C claimed improvement is about right, and everything runs great now.

I really didn't expect great results and have been amazed that it does what it says. I've never overclocked the 8800GT (625/1800, I think) and don't expect I will because of the heat and my case.
